Vincent: Ohhh how do you like FF4? I just bought FF chronicles with 4 and Chrono trigger in one package. I played Chrono for the 64th time but I haven't tried ff4 yet. And right now I'm playing Star ocean second story and I just received FFXIII in the mail!

FF 4 is one of my favourites - one of the first games in the series that I played, and probably the one I've replayed the most. I would recommend the PSP version over Chronicles, because it has a new Interlude and the sequel, and also the Chronicles version has music that restarts every time you exit a battle and really ridiculous load times - you could also grab the GBA or original SNES version (though the SNES version is named FF 2). Also if you're a Chrono fan you might want to consider the DS version - I believe it has some extra content, as well as the anime cutscenes. The PSX version has the cutscenes too, but again the load times are pretty bad.
